Sr. Systems Engineer - Cisco Routing Switching
Senior Network Systems Engineer
SyTec Business Solutions is the premier provider of computer networking service in the Central NC area. We design, install and maintain local and wide area networks for business clients who either don't have their own IT staff or need assistance on projects. We focus on providing premium quality customer serviceand quick response.
This position is categorized as a Senior Network SE position. Employee will work as a part of a team providing onsite support and project work for SyTec clients in the Raleigh, Durham, Chapel Hill area. This is full time employment opportunity, not a contract. SyTec is a well established and growing company with a solid reputation for providing high quality networking design, service and support. There is opportunity for leadership and professional growth.
Requirements:
Min 5 Yrs experience as an SE supporting Microsoft and Cisco products directly.
Cisco Command set/IOS skills and experience.
Cisco router/switch configurations and troubleshooting.
VLAN setup and management.
Layer 3 switching configuration.
Microsoft Windows Server installation/management/troubleshooting experience
Understanding of Active Directory.
Strong understanding of networking concepts such as OSI Model, packet architecture, security, authentication.
Proactive and enthusiastic attitude
Strong troubleshooting skills
Strong communication and customer service skills are essential.
Professional bearing and manner
Very little travel required – Avg less than 2 days/month
Must pass drug test and background screening
Preferred:
Microsoft Certified Systems Engineer 2003 (MCSE 2k3)
Cisco Certified Design/Network Associate (CCDA/CCNA)
Microsoft Exchange Experience
Cisco Unified Communication Manager experience.
Cisco firewall experience
Duties:
The Senior Systems Engineer is responsible for designing and installing networking technologies for clients, and supporting clients and their networks. The Systems Engineer configures the equipment and software to meet client business needs and documents the solution for ongoing support. The Systems Engineer can function as part of or lead an implementation team on larger projects, or individually provides the services on support visits or smaller projects. The Systems Engineer may also provide technical support to the sales staff and assist with the design of LAN/WAN-based solutions.
